//find the desktop window for message handling (hide/show desktop icons)
HWND gethShellViewWin() {
HWND prgMan = FindWindowA("Progman", "Program Manager");
HWND hShellViewWin = FindWindowExA(prgMan, 0, "SHELLDLL_DefView", "");
if(hShellViewWin == 0x00) {
HWND hWorkerW = 0x00;
do {
hWorkerW = FindWindowExA(0, hWorkerW, "WorkerW", "");
hShellViewWin = FindWindowExA(hWorkerW, 0, "SHELLDLL_DefView", "");
} while (hShellViewWin == 0x00 && hWorkerW != 0x00);
}
return hShellViewWin;
}
